Filters:
camping store in Wolfscastle
About 2 results.
Halfords
Meadow Walk 1, SA61 2EX Haverfordwest, United KingdomLooking for Halfords 0486HAVERFORD WEST store? You'll find the address, postcode, phone number, map opening hours and store info on halfords.com.